Mild Sorrow Integrated starts off the new era of No Agreements with his newest EP "Eye Girl," a thirteen minute long song that is as progressive as it is frantic.
Eye Girl evokes imagery of spaceships catapulting through machinery grave yards, meteors, and debris at high speeds; providing a sense of flow shrouded in passing obstacles that dictate a constantly weaving course.
There's never a boring moment in this adrenaline pumping release, an iconic sudden shift into the new era of the label.
